2-liter stainless steel pressure cookers are versatile kitchen appliances that can be used for various culinary applications. These are some scenarios where one can use the pressure cooker:
Cooking Pulses and Legumes:
Cooking beans, lentils, and chickpeas can take a long time. However, with a pressure cooker, one can cook them perfectly within 30 minutes. It can even soften tougher legumes quickly.
Preparing Meat Dishes:
Pressure cookers are perfect for cooking meat dishes like curries, stews, and soups. The high pressure and temperature inside the pot can tenderize cuts of meat quickly, making them juicy and flavorful.
Canning Foods:
Pressure cookers work well for home canning. They can create a vacuum seal in jars, preserving fruits, vegetables, and sauces for later use.
Cooking Rice and Grains:
Cooking different types of rice, such as basmati, jasmine, brown, or wild rice, can be easy in a pressure cooker. One can also cook other grains like quinoa, farro, and barley.
Making Soups and Stocks:
Pressure cookers are excellent for making soups and stocks. The high pressure extracts flavors from ingredients quickly, resulting in a delicious broth. One can make vegetable soup, chicken stock, or beef broth in no time.
Cooking Vegetables:
Vegetables like carrots, potatoes, and green beans retain their nutrients and natural flavors when cooked under pressure. Using a pressure cooker to prepare vegetable sides or stews can save time and preserve the freshness of the produce.
Making Desserts:
Desserts like rice pudding, cheesecakes, and even steamed puddings can be made in pressure cookers. The sealed environment ensures consistent cooking, making pressure cookers great for sweet treats.

Size:
This is an important factor to consider, especially for big families. Most pressure cookers come in different sizes, starting from 2 litres, 4 litres, 6 litres, and 8 litres. A 2-litre pressure cooker is great for cooking small batches of rice and lentils and for one or two people. A 4-litre pressure cooker is suitable for cooking small to medium-sized meals for up to four people. A 6-litre pressure cooker can cook an entire meal for a small family, including rice, meat, and vegetables, in one pot. An 8-litre cooker is suitable for a large family or for hosting guests.
Material:
Most pressure cookers are made with stainless steel materials, which are durable and resistant to corrosion or rust. They are also good for heat conduction and can work on all types of heat sources. Another material is aluminum, which is lightweight and has good heat conduction but cannot be used on an induction cooktop.

Q4: Does cooking in a pressure cooker retain nutrients?
A4: Yes, pressure cooking helps preserve nutrients in food. Since pressure cooking occurs quickly and with less water, it reduces the chances of water-soluble vitamins (like B and C) getting destroyed by prolonged exposure to heat or leaching into cooking water.
